GreekG7662Noun (Feminine)

θέσις

thesis

0Occurrences
G7662Strong's #
Noun (Feminine)Part of Speech

Definition

Full Lexicon Entry(Abbott-Smith)
1.a setting, placing, arranging, (Pindar); θ. *νόμων *lawgiving, (Demosthenes Orator)
2.a deposit of money, preparatory to a law-suit, (Aristophanes Comicus): money paid in advance, earnest-money, (Demosthenes Orator)
3.position, situation, Lat. situs, of a city, (Thucydides), etc.
